When launching an inflatable life raft, you should make sure that the operating cord is _______________.

Afastened to some substantial part of the vessel
Bnot fastened to anything
Csecured to the hydrostatic release
Dfastened to the raft container
AI Explanation

The correct answer is A) fastened to some substantial part of the vessel. When launching an inflatable life raft, the operating cord should be fastened to a substantial part of the vessel, such as a strong point or the deck. This ensures that the raft can be launched effectively and does not drift away from the vessel. Leaving the cord unattached (option B) or attaching it to the raft container (option D) would not properly secure the raft during launch. Option C, securing the cord to the hydrostatic release, is also incorrect, as the hydrostatic release is a separate mechanism responsible for automatically releasing the raft in the event of sinking.
